What are the four main types of biological molecules?
- Carbohydrates
- Lipid
- Protein
- Nucleotide
What element is present in all organic biological molecules?
Carbon
What elements are found in carbohydrates?
Carbon (C), hydrogen (H), and oxygen (O)
What elements are found in lipids?
Carbon (C), hydrogen (H), and oxygen (O
What elements are found in proteins?
Carbon (C), hydrogen (H), oxygen (O), and nitrogen (N)
What elements are found in nucleic acids?
Carbon (C), hydrogen (H), oxygen (O), nitrogen (N), and phosphorus (P)
What is a monomer?
A smaller unit that combines to make a large molecule (polymer)
What is a polymer?
A large molecule made up of many repeating units of monomers joined together by chemical bonds
What is the process of monomers joining to form a polymer called?
Polymerisation
What is the monomer of carbohydrates?
Monosaccharides
What is the polymer of carbohydrates?
Polysaccharides
What is the monomer of proteins?
Amino acids
What is the polymer of proteins?
Polypeptides
What is the monomer of nucleic acids?
Nucleotides
What is the polymer of nucleic acids?
Polynucleotides
What is condensation reaction?
The removal of water to form a chemical bond between two molecules
What is hydrolysis reaction?
The addition of water to break a chemical bond between two molecules
